加入收藏 | 设为首页 | 会员中心 | 我要投稿 92站长网 (https://www.92zhanzhang.com/)- 视觉智能、智能语音交互、边缘计算、物联网、开发!
当前位置: 首页 > 综合聚焦 > 编程要点 > 语言 > 正文

Python数据分析:高效技巧与实践策略深度解析

发布时间:2025-09-13 10:24:21 所属栏目:语言 来源:DaWei
导读: 在数据驱动决策日益成为主流的今天,Python凭借其简洁易读的语法和强大的第三方库,已经成为数据分析领域的首选语言之一。Pandas、NumPy、Matplotlib和Seaborn等库的广泛应用,使Python在数据清洗、处理、可视化

在数据驱动决策日益成为主流的今天,Python凭借其简洁易读的语法和强大的第三方库,已经成为数据分析领域的首选语言之一。Pandas、NumPy、Matplotlib和Seaborn等库的广泛应用,使Python在数据清洗、处理、可视化及建模等方面展现出极高的效率。


数据分析的第一步通常是数据清洗,而Pandas提供了非常灵活的DataFrame结构,能够高效地处理缺失值、重复数据和异常值。使用`fillna()`、`drop_duplicates()`和`apply()`等方法,可以快速完成数据预处理任务,从而为后续分析打下坚实基础。


在进行数据探索时,熟练掌握分组聚合操作(GroupBy)是提升效率的关键。通过将数据按照特定维度进行分组,并结合聚合函数如`mean()`、`sum()`或自定义函数,可以快速获得数据的统计特征,发现潜在规律。


可视化是数据分析中不可或缺的一环,它能帮助我们更直观地理解数据分布与趋势。Matplotlib作为基础绘图库提供了高度定制化的选项,而Seaborn则基于Matplotlib进行了封装,提供了更美观的默认样式和更简洁的接口,适用于快速生成高质量图表。


随着数据量的增长,传统的单机处理方式可能面临性能瓶颈。此时,Dask和Modin等扩展库可以作为Pandas的替代方案,它们兼容Pandas接口的同时支持并行计算,能够有效提升大数据处理的效率。


除了处理结构化数据,Python在文本数据分析方面也表现出色。借助NLTK、spaCy和TextBlob等自然语言处理库,技术写作者可以轻松实现文本清洗、情感分析和关键词提取等功能,为非结构化数据的分析提供有力支持。


在构建可复用的数据分析流程方面,Jupyter Notebook与PyCharm等工具各具优势。Jupyter适合快速验证思路和展示结果,而PyCharm更适合构建模块化、工程化的分析脚本。合理使用这两种工具,有助于提升开发效率与代码质量。


2025AI生成的计划图,仅供参考

版本控制与文档编写是保障数据分析项目可持续发展的关键。Git配合GitHub或GitLab平台,可以有效管理代码变更。而使用Sphinx或MkDocs等工具撰写清晰的技术文档,不仅能提升团队协作效率,也有助于知识沉淀与传承。

(编辑:92站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章